What are the environmental conditions and calibration parameters for particle counter APSS 200 liquid sampler? - ´ð°¸
The environmental conditions must meet temperatures between 4-40° C and humidity between 0-95% (non-condensing). Other parameters/specifications include:
- The instrument size range is 2-125 um
- The instrument samples 100% of the fluid (and particles) passing through the instrument
- The instrument is calibrated every year
- The maximum particle concentration is 10,000 (cumulative) particles per mL
- The instrument should only sample particles in deionized water
- Calibrations are performed to standards from NIST, ISO 4402 and ASTM-F658
